Beating South Korea Will Be Extremely Difficult: Coach Otto Addo

It would be difficult for Ghana to defeat South Korea in their second group encounter, according to coach Otto Addo.

The Black Stars’ 2022 World Cup campaign began against Portugal on Thursday at the 974 Stadium.

Sadly enough, the European team upset the four-time African champions 3-2.

Monday’s match between Ghana and South Korea at the Education City Stadium is scheduled to begin at 13:00 GMT.

Addo stated that they needed to defeat the Koreans in order to proceed to the competition’s next round before the game against the Asian squad.

When asked if Ghana can advance to the competition’s second round after its match against Portugal, the 49-year-old responded, “First of all, certainly, we have a chance, especially because they played a draw.

“If we win against South Korea and Portugal wins, hopefully, against Uruguay, then we will be second, so the chance is still great.

“And surely it will be very, very tough to beat South Korea because they are good. But now we have to win.

“We are under pressure but they are too,” he iterated.

Portugal now leads the group after the outcome, but given that South Korea and Uruguay drew 0-0 earlier in the day, the Black Stars’ loss today might not be too costly.

At Al Janoub Stadium in Al Wakrah, Ghana’s group stage campaign will come to a thrilling conclusion when they take on Uruguay.
